Raids are being conducted on the premises of Income Tax Department Shiv Sena Leader Rahul Kanal in Mumbai, officials said.

The raids have been conducted in connection with alleged tax evasion by Yashwant Jadhav, chairman of the standing committee of the Brihanmumbai Municipal Corporation (BMC). Kanal is a member of Education Committee of BMC and Trustee of Shri Sai Baba Sansthan Trust, Shirdi.

The department had searched Jadhav’s premises on February 25 and found benami properties worth Rs 130 crore. The department had said in a statement that it had also searched some BMC contractors and found that they had not disclosed income of Rs 200 crore. IT officials said they have found “evidence” which indicates a “close nexus” between Jadhav and these contractors.
